Reaffirming the state government's unwavering commitment to youth empowerment and administrative accountability, Uttar Pradesh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ath hosted an extensive "Janta Darshan" on Monday. Interacting directly with citizens, complainants, and aspiring athletes at his official residence, the Chief Minister delivered a powerful message to young sportsperson, assuring them that stellar performances on national and international stages will be rewarded with priority government appointments. The high-level interaction also featured strict warnings to bureaucratic personnel regarding public grievance redressal alongside compassionate appeals for domestic harmony.

Winning Medals Guarantees Priority Government Jobs and State Support

During his interaction with young athletes and sports aspirants who visited the Janta Darshan,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ath encouraged them to intensify their training regimens and aim for podium finishes at international tournaments. Highlighting the state's proactive sports policy, he noted that the Uttar Pradesh government provides substantial cash prize money and direct recruitment opportunities into prestigious state positions, having already successfully inducted numerous medal-winning athletes into roles such as Deputy Superintendent of Police (DSP) and Tehsildar. He urged youth to channel dedication and perseverance into sports, assuring them that state backing will never fall short for those who bring glory to the nation and the state.

Resolving Family Disputes Internally and Prioritizing Children's Welfare

Shifting focus to social harmony, the Chief Minister also addressed citizens struggling with domestic and familial discord. Advising complainants who sought mediation in personal matters, he strongly recommended resolving family disputes internally within the presence of senior family members and elders rather than involving external parties. Emphasizing that outside interference often complicates personal matters and inflicts psychological distress on growing children, he stressed that maintaining domestic peace is fundamental to societal well-being and child development.

Strict Administrative Warnings Against Delays in Revenue and Police Cases

Demonstrating zero tolerance for bureaucratic apathy, the Chief Minister conducted a rigorous review of pending grievances related to revenue and local police departments. Directing pointed inquiries at officials responsible for procedural delays, he issued a strict warning that disciplinary action would be initiated against employees failing to resolve public applications within stipulated timeframes. Concluding the public interaction on a warm note, the Chief Minister engaged playfully with accompanying children, distributing chocolates, asking about their academic progress, and inspiring them to pursue diligent education.
